Good Friends Hugo the Happy Starfish Ebook Review

Disclosure: I got this product as part of an advertorial.



This Hugo book brings to story of friendship. Hugo and Seedo are out and about. They land on an island and Seedo has a horn that he blows every time a potential friend comes along. Each one is turned down by Hugo because he believes that all friends should look like him. Hugo, in the end, learns that friends come in all shapes, sizes and colors. No friend is exactly like you!


Hugo ends up meeting a lot of unique and special friends. This is great for those in elementary school. Shows them not everyone is the same.
